Health Sciences Research Center (HSRC) are two independent
research centers associated with Asthma & Allergy Associates
P.C. Located in Cortland and Elmira, New York, HSRC draws from the
medical practice, which covers regions in Cortland, Tompkins,
Chemung, and Broome Counties.
HSRC has conducted numerous Phase II, III, and IV clinical
trials in varying therapeutic areas.

Our initial research complex was built in the fall of 2003, and our newest site was completed in March 2005.
A quick view of both equally equipped sites includes twenty private examination rooms, state-of-the-art equipment available to perform EKGs, pulmonary function, skin testing and adult/pediatric phlebotomy. Our CLIA-certified laboratories are equipped with a -20 degree and -70 degree freezer and a defibrillator. Calibration records are available for all equipment. We have IATA Hazmat certified staff.
We also house an impressive patient lounge which is particularly convenient for long visits with "at-home amenities" such as cable television, VCR, DVD, desktop workspace, reclining chairs, and a patient refrigerator.

HSRC investigators have performed over 125 clinical trials. Collectively, our investigators are board certified in Pediatrics, Internal Medicine and Allergy and Immunology, and have training in Good Clinical Practice.
The entire staff at HSRC has gained recognition as our region's leaders in clinical research. HSRC employs Physician Assistants, Certified Family Nurse Practitioner, Registered Nurse CCRC, and regulatory affairs personnel. Our staff training includes: IATA HAZMAT and Good Clinical Practice. Health Sciences Research Center has established Standard Operating Procedures and extensive training logs for its staff.
